Silent Pool Gin is produced on the Albury Estate in the Surrey Hills, right next to the Silent Pool, a beautiful, mysterious spring-fed lake - what a place to create a gin! The gin itself features 24 botanicals, including makrut lime, chamomile, local honey and lavender, among others, resulting in a subtly sweet though intricately-balanced tipple.
Violet, lavender and lime leaf bring floral aromatics to the nose, while cardamom and juniper give it a spicy edge.
Elderflower, chamomile and a waft of orange blossom. Warming honey sweetness and a spark of black pepper.
Vanilla-rich honey notes last on the finish.
